Cavusoglu: Turkey-Azerbaijan brotherhood strengthening
Foreign policy
- 01 April, 2021
- 08:29
From now on, mutual trips between Azerbaijan and Turkey will be carried out using IDs, Turkish Foreign Minister Mevlut Cavusoglu tweeted, Report informs.
“All obstacles are being removed, and our brotherhood is growing stronger. Let it benefit our citizens and Azerbaijani brothers,” the foreign minister wrote.
